BlockArmor is an add-on that adds a total of 26 new armors made of different rock materials to Minecraft. Some of these armors will have special abilities when used, either by having the complete set or by only having a part of the armor.
Compatibility✔️
- You can use it with almost any addon as this addon DOES NOT USE PLAYER.JSON, so it will be compatible with almost any addon, and you can easily put it at the end if you want.
Experimental Options👾
- Does not require any experimental options!

Block Armor Config
This menu allows players to configure the Block Armor addon directly in-game. From here, players can enable or disable armor abilities, read a quick usage guide, or reset the configuration back to its default values.
General Settings
This button opens the general addon settings. These options affect the overall behavior of Block Armor.
All Armor Abilities
Enables or disables all armor abilities at the same time.
If this option is disabled, the armor sets will not apply their special powers, even if their individual options are enabled.
Armor Warnings
Enables or disables the help messages shown in the actionbar.
These messages are useful for informing players about armor effects, warnings, or special mechanics while using the addon.
Armor Powers
This button opens the list of individual armor abilities. From this menu, players can enable or disable each armor power separately depending on their preference.
How To Use
This button opens a quick guide for players.
It explains how to open the configuration menu, how the armors work, and reminds players that some abilities require the full armor set to activate.
Reset Settings
This button allows players to reset the addon configuration.
After confirming, all Block Armor options will be enabled again, just like the default settings.

Update V1.3:
In this update, skills were added for Magma Armor and Lapis Lazuli Armor.
Lapis Armor:
Lapis armor will allow you to gain experience every time you mine a mineral in the game, it can also work with vanilla minerals as long as the custom block id contains "_ore", the amount of experience goes up as the parts of the armor increase.
Magma Armor:
The magma armor will allow you to damage the entities that attack you, the amount of damage increases as the parts of the armor increase.
